在浩瀚的宇宙中,人类对于星际旅行的梦想从未停止。而行星引力,作为宇宙中最基本的力之一,对于星际探险有着深远的影响。今天,就让我们一起揭开行星引力的神秘面纱,探究它是如何影响我们的星际之旅的。
引力:宇宙中的隐形拉力
首先,我们来了解一下引力。引力是宇宙中最基本的力之一,它作用于任何有质量的物体之间。根据牛顿的万有引力定律,两个物体之间的引力与它们的质量成正比,与它们之间距离的平方成反比。这个定律为我们揭示了引力在宇宙中的普遍存在。
行星引力与星际旅行
在星际旅行中,行星引力扮演着重要的角色。以下是几个关键点:
1. 引力助力:利用行星引力加速
在星际旅行中,利用行星引力加速是一种常见的手段。这种方法被称为引力助推。具体来说,航天器可以在接近行星时,借助行星的引力来加速,从而减少燃料消耗。
# 引力助推示例代码
class Spacecraft:
def __init__(self, mass, velocity):
self.mass = mass # 质量
self.velocity = velocity # 速度
def gravity_assist(self, planet_mass, distance):
# 根据万有引力定律计算加速效果
force = G * self.mass * planet_mass / (distance ** 2)
acceleration = force / self.mass
self.velocity += acceleration * time_step
# 定义引力常数G和模拟时间步长
G = 6.67430e-11 # N·m²/kg²
time_step = 1 # 时间步长(秒)
# 创建航天器实例
spacecraft = Spacecraft(mass=10000, velocity=0)
# 调用引力助推方法
spacecraft.gravity_assist(planet_mass=5.972e24, distance=7.5e8)
print("加速后速度:", spacecraft.velocity)
2. 引力陷阱:避免被行星引力束缚
在星际旅行中,我们必须避免被行星引力束缚。例如,当航天器接近木星等大型行星时,可能会被其强大的引力所捕获。为了避免这种情况,航天器需要保持适当的轨道高度和速度。
3. 引力助推与引力陷阱的平衡
在星际旅行中,我们需要在引力助推和引力陷阱之间找到平衡。一方面,我们要利用行星引力加速;另一方面,又要避免被引力束缚。这需要精确的计算和判断。
实际案例:旅行者1号
旅行者1号探测器是迄今为止人类发射的最远的航天器。它在穿越太阳系的过程中,多次利用行星引力加速。例如,在接近木星时,旅行者1号借助木星的引力,速度提高了大约6公里/秒。
总结
行星引力在星际旅行中起着至关重要的作用。通过合理利用引力助推,我们可以减少燃料消耗,提高航天器的速度。然而,我们也要注意避免被引力陷阱所束缚。在未来,随着航天技术的不断发展,人类将更好地掌握行星引力,实现更加深入的宇宙探险。
